This show aired live on Wednesday, January 22, 2020 at 4:00 pm. (cst) The News from the Community was first, then Cedric de Leon, Ph.D. author of the book "Crisis" was the guest. He's the Director of the Labor Center and Associate Professor of Sociology at the University of Massachusetts Amherst. He In analyzes two pivotal crises in the American two-party system: the first resulting in the demise of the Whig party and secession of eleven southern states in 1861, and the present crisis splintering the Democratic and Republican parties and leading to the election of Donald Trump.
